Subject: [PATCH 3.16 17/26] uas: Only complain about missing sg if all other checks succeed

3.16-stable review patch.  If anyone has any objections, please let me know.

------------------

From: Hans de Goede <hdegoede@...hat.com>

commit cc4deafc86f75f4e716b37fb4ea3572eb1e49e50 upstream.

Don't complain about controllers without sg support if there are other
reasons why uas cannot be used anyways.

Signed-off-by: Hans de Goede <hdegoede@...hat.com>
Signed-off-by: Greg Kroah-Hartman <gregkh@...uxfoundation.org>

---
 drivers/usb/storage/uas-detect.h |   28 ++++++++++------------------
 1 file changed, 10 insertions(+), 18 deletions(-)

--- a/drivers/usb/storage/uas-detect.h
+++ b/drivers/usb/storage/uas-detect.h
@@ -9,32 +9,15 @@ static int uas_is_interface(struct usb_h
 		intf->desc.bInterfaceProtocol == USB_PR_UAS);
 }
 
-static int uas_isnt_supported(struct usb_device *udev)
-{
-	struct usb_hcd *hcd = bus_to_hcd(udev->bus);
-
-	dev_warn(&udev->dev, "The driver for the USB controller %s does not "
-			"support scatter-gather which is\n",
-			hcd->driver->description);
-	dev_warn(&udev->dev, "required by the UAS driver. Please try an"
-			"alternative USB controller if you wish to use UAS.\n");
-	return -ENODEV;
-}
-
 static int uas_find_uas_alt_setting(struct usb_interface *intf)
 {
 	int i;
-	struct usb_device *udev = interface_to_usbdev(intf);
-	int sg_supported = udev->bus->sg_tablesize != 0;
 
 	for (i = 0; i < intf->num_altsetting; i++) {
 		struct usb_host_interface *alt = &intf->altsetting[i];
 
-		if (uas_is_interface(alt)) {
-			if (!sg_supported)
-				return uas_isnt_supported(udev);
+		if (uas_is_interface(alt))
 			return alt->desc.bAlternateSetting;
-		}
 	}
 
 	return -ENODEV;
@@ -92,5 +75,14 @@ static int uas_use_uas_driver(struct usb
 	if (r < 0)
 		return 0;
 
+	if (udev->bus->sg_tablesize == 0) {
+		dev_warn(&udev->dev,
+			"The driver for the USB controller %s does not support scatter-gather which is\n",
+			hcd->driver->description);
+		dev_warn(&udev->dev,
+			"required by the UAS driver. Please try an other USB controller if you wish to use UAS.\n");
+		return 0;
+	}
+
 	return 1;
 }
